Analytic
cubism was jointly developed by Pablo Picasso and Georges Braque, from
about 1908 through 1912.

Pollock's friend and patron Alfonso Osorio described what is so unique and compelling
about Pollock's work by saying
about his artistic journey, «Here I saw a man who had both broken all the traditions of the past and unified them, who had gone beyond
cubism, beyond Picasso and surrealism, beyond everything that had happened in art... his work expressed both action and contemplation.»
